Transaction 861378387e09709028a58125ef3d64636fc3554e8d59210ab0e6b7605876d1b3
1 Input
1 Output
-
861378387e09709028a58125ef3d64636fc3554e8d59210ab0e6b7605876d1b3:0
- value
- 6854760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d07906dd85d9ba594762e0a314e61caf8249edf3 OP_EQUAL
- address
- 3LhKTXzeT1qwGAj25iXkZYtPjxumr4rH5h